- 冻(凍)[dòng]
- 动词- (液体或含水分的东西遇冷凝固) freeze:
The engine has frozen up.发动机冻住了。
The stream has frozen up; you can see the fish trapped in the ice.小河冻起来了,你可以看见冻在冰里的鱼。
- (受冷或感到冷) feel very cold; freeze; be frostbitten:Put on more clothes so you don't catch cold.多穿些,别冻着。
Her hands were frostbitten.她手都冻了。
- 名词- (凝结成半固体的汤汁) jelly:
plum jelly;李 [梅]子冻
apple [orange] jelly;苹果[桔子]冻
- (姓氏) a surname:Dong Tai冻泰
